follow up question: is the mission district safe these days? Particularly the area around Portrero and 21st?

At this point in the search I seem to be honing in on living in SF proper as I have realized the cost of Single family home rentals with parking and small yards are about the same cost anywhere within a 1 hour commute of SF (areas like san bruno/ssf/daly city/berkeley/san rafael) etc.

Really liking what I have seen in Bernal Heights, Noe Valley, and Mission district, but again I want to be in an area that isn't rife with things like home burglaries etc.

Those neighborhoods get more sunny days then then some other areas of SF.


Off the top of my head, I would say there are safer areas of SF in regard to property crime. But, you could do worse. Noe & Bernal are 2 neighborhoods that come to mind as being better. I am assuming that you have come across a dwelling that may fit your needs & budget in the area of 21st & Potrero
If I was in your shoes and found a dwelling that I really liked, I would not rule out living in that area
